As one of the most controversial dictators of history, Augusto Pinochet still generates a lot of debate in his country about his legacy, decades after his fall. He turned Chile into one of the most successful South American countries. In the same time more than 3,000 people were killed.
Surprisingly Augusto Pinochet's daughter Lucía is approached by his father's fans in the streets of Santiago de Chile. But to certain areas of the country she is afraid to go as she fears she would be beaten up because of her father. She accepts the fact that her father was a dictator but she believes he was a good one... In the film Lucía Pinochet recalls tense conversations with her father and with the head of the secret service while sharing the atmosphere of a loving and warm family environment. Eventually she meets one of the most outspoken critic of her father.

The program presents some of the most influential dictators of the 20th century from Africa to South America through the eyes of their children and relatives. The hour-long episodes bring a rarely seen personal perspective on history and offer a deeper understanding of the most feared leaders in the world while focusing on the portraits of their children.
The filmmakers worked without a crew, with only two small broadcast cameras in order to have undisturbed and exclusive access to children of dictators, namely Lucia Pinochet in Chile, Jaffar Amin in Uganda, Bettina Göring in Germany and Fidel Castro's daughter in Miami.

Directed by Eszter Cseke & Andras S. Takacs
